I. Personality traits of narcissistic people

The personality traits of narcissistic people often include a lack of self-esteem and an improper self-awareness. They often have intense self-love and feel the need to be admired and cared for by others to fulfill their self-esteem. This leads them to seek narcissistic supply from external sources, often through using relationships with others.

A narcissistic personality often shows a lack of self-esteem and intense self-love, which makes them indifferent to the feelings, opinions, or interests of others. Instead, they are only concerned with achieving personal gain and presenting themselves as superior and excellent in the eyes of others.

Another aspect of the narcissistic personality is the use of others as a means to achieve personal goals without regard for the consequences or their feelings. This creates a one-sided and unbalanced relationship model, where the narcissist often puts themselves at the center and only cares about their own benefits, regardless of whether it hurts others or not.

II. Narcissistic supply and its importance in relationships

In every relationship, narcissistic supply plays an important role, especially with people who have narcissistic personalities. Narcissistic supply is the factor that provides the admiration, support, or nurturing essential for a narcissist’s self-esteem. This often happens excessively, as they need to be given special attention and care, even to a pathological extent.

In a relationship with a narcissist, providing narcissistic supply is often the decisive factor in the success or failure of that relationship. Narcissists often feel more self-worth and confidence when they receive admiration and attention from others. This motivates them to continuously seek and demand narcissistic supply from their surroundings, not only from their partners but also from family, friends, and colleagues.

However, providing narcissistic supply is not always easy and can cause a lot of stress in the relationship. The necessity and decisive element of narcissistic supply can create an unbalanced relationship model and pose many risks in communication and interaction. This also drives the narcissist to continue seeking new sources of supply when an old one no longer meets their needs, leading to instability in the relationship and the risk of it breaking down.

In summary, understanding narcissistic supply and its importance in relationships is a crucial part of understanding more deeply the personality and behavior of narcissistic people, thereby having appropriate approaches and ways of handling interactions with them.

III. The psychological mechanism that makes narcissists easily abandon loved ones

One of the noteworthy aspects of the narcissistic personality is how they often abandon the loved ones in their lives. This usually stems from a lack of self-esteem and an uncontrolled need for narcissistic supply. Narcissists often cannot determine the true value of a relationship and prioritize their self-love, even above relationships with loved ones.

The psychological mechanism that makes narcissists easily abandon loved ones is often related to a lack of self-esteem and the need for admiration and attention. They often only value relationships that can bring them benefits, and ignore relationships that they do not find useful. This can lead to them placing personal relationships and narcissistic supply above even family relationships and friendships.

At the same time, this psychological mechanism can also be related to the narcissist’s discomfort and dissatisfaction when they do not receive attention and narcissistic supply from loved ones. They may feel inferior and unworthy, and therefore decide to abandon loved ones to seek validation and supply from other sources.

IV. A deeper analysis of negative supply and its impact

Negative supply is an important part of a narcissist’s operating mechanism; it includes factors like the failure, suffering, anger, and dissatisfaction of others, which they use to satisfy their own self-esteem needs. This often leads to toxic behaviors that harm those around them.

Although negative supply cannot be seen, it is very important in maintaining the narcissist’s self-esteem. They feel powerful and valued when they receive attention and focus from others, even from their negative experiences. This creates a cycle of dependence and self-sustenance, making it easy for the narcissist to fall into behaviors that require negative supply to feel satisfied and confident.

The impact of negative supply doesn’t just stop at the individual level but also affects their social and family relationships. Toxic behaviors and dependence on negative supply can weaken their relationships with those around them and cause stress and conflict in social and family environments.

Therefore, understanding negative supply and its impact is important to be able to effectively address and cope with the behavior and psychology of narcissists, while also providing support and help for them in the process of recovery and development.

VI. Effective methods to solve the problem of abandonment by narcissists

To solve the problem of being abandoned by a narcissist, it is necessary to clearly understand the causes and apply effective methods. One of the important methods is to establish clear boundaries in the relationship. This way, loved ones can protect themselves from the control and abuse from the narcissist.

Additionally, creating a safe and supportive environment for the loved one is also important. This may include seeking support from friends, family, or mental health professionals. By doing this, they can find the necessary help and advice to face the difficult situation.

Furthermore, implementing self-protection measures is important. This may include learning about and understanding the narcissistic personality, thereby being able to detect and stay away from relationships with high psychological risks. At the same time, enhancing self-confidence and self-care abilities also helps loved ones cope better with the situation.

Finally, seeking support from experts is very important. Those with knowledge and experience in working with narcissists can provide loved ones with specific methods and tools to cope with difficult situations and protect themselves from psychological harm.
